What We Believe

Sevenoseven On Campus exists to tell of the best possible way of life, that of Jesus Christ. We believe that the way he lived and the principles he taught truly give life abundant to those that follow.

We devote ourselves to the breaking of bread and to fellowship, believing that authentic community and true love happen this way. We devote ourselves to the scriptures and to prayer knowing that communion with the Almighty brings freedom.

It is our hope that we can come alongside local ministries to advance the kingdom of God as opposed to dividing it.
We believe that our source of authority and guidance is the Bible, not man's wisdom.
The focus of our ministry is God's love for people, not programs.


The message of Sevenoseven On Campus is found in the person of Jesus Christ.
We believe that people grow best in an authentic, caring community.
The goal of Sevenoseven On Campus is to produce passionate followers of Jesus.
We believe that every Christian has a God-given ministry to serve.
